From daily operations to working software.
- 01
Collect supporting records
Basis: assembled items and outstanding items. Use reviewed records as the billing basis. Missing information becomes a review item rather than an invented amount.
- 02
Review differences
Price agreement: assembly minutes and floor charges. Compare execution with the agreement. Review differences before they enter the invoice draft.
- 03
Transfer the draft
Evidence: assembly job card at delivery address. Keep a reference to the work record. Prevent duplicate transfers and show when an integration fails.

Good to know.
What should we provide for billing integration?
An example of assembled items and outstanding items, the current workflow and who can approve changes. Avoid customer data during the initial discussion. We then agree relevant fields and exceptions.
Can this connect with assembly minutes and floor charges?
We assess the source and available access. An API may fit, or a controlled import may be more appropriate. We also agree how missing information, failures and duplicate transfers are handled.
